Frequently asked questions

What rhymes perfectly with scarred?
Perfect rhymes include starred, barred, jarred, marred, charred, sparred, tarred, disbarred, hard-scarred, and regard. These all share the '-arred' or '-ard' ending sound and work well in any verse structure. 'Starred' and 'marred' are especially useful because they carry contrasting emotional tones - celestial vs. damaged - letting you build lyrical tension.
What are near rhymes for scarred?
Strong near rhymes include hard, card, guard, yard, scarce, scared, scored, and carved. These approximate the vowel-consonant combination closely enough to feel natural in a chorus or bridge. 'Hard' and 'guard' are especially popular in hip-hop and rock for their punchy, one-syllable impact next to 'scarred.'
What are slant rhymes for scarred?
Useful slant rhymes include heart, dark, mark, start, sharp, far, war, and shard. These share partial sounds - the 'ar' vowel or the hard consonant ending - and are widely used in poetry and rap where emotional resonance matters more than exact phonetic matching. 'Heart' and 'dark' are especially powerful pairings given the emotional register of 'scarred.'
How do you use scarred in a rap song?
In rap, 'scarred' hits best at the end of a bar where you want gravity and finality. Pair it with 'starred' for an aspirational contrast, or use 'barred' and 'charred' for a darker, street-level narrative. Multi-syllable setups like 'left me scarred' or 'battle-scarred' let you land the rhyme with a natural rhythmic punch. Emotionally heavy rappers like Eminem and Logic use this type of vocabulary to anchor confessional verses.
What is the best rhyme scheme for scarred in poetry?
An ABAB or AABB scheme works cleanly with 'scarred' because its perfect rhymes like 'starred' and 'marred' are easy to use naturally in consecutive lines. For a more complex emotional effect, try an ABCB scheme where 'scarred' falls on the B rhyme, giving it repeated emphasis without becoming predictable. Slant rhyme pairings with 'heart' and 'dark' work especially well in free verse or modern spoken word poetry.
